Output fb91b031ee01b7531cdcc8e6257b1882d88bd4fd80caad2ef88d960ae94889e4:7

value
368435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d509aef02c7ee8d77e35b855f15476df2a67f95 OP_EQUALVERIFY OP_CHECKSIG
address
13g1A7TA45a2X4PRdQeK34DGLKkpuzpx8M
transaction
fb91b031ee01b7531cdcc8e6257b1882d88bd4fd80caad2ef88d960ae94889e4
spent
true